Output c8af3020d3a78da56d5bb3cf6133b35cc8a6ad9acf272f6b74e73c5edd1016c6:1

value
16785986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ffeb551b483a920725bb9c6ca73e6ad4b581bbd OP_EQUAL
address
3LenvhD5JwTzDJ4Tp4AmrS7Lspn4eEVY1Q
transaction
c8af3020d3a78da56d5bb3cf6133b35cc8a6ad9acf272f6b74e73c5edd1016c6
confirmations
446456
spent
true